Vertical Computer Systems, Inc. v. Interwoven,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: Vertical Computer Systems Inc
Defendant: Interwoven Inc
Case Number: 3:2011cv02425
Filed: May 18, 2011
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of California
Office: San Francisco Office
County: XX US, Outside State
Presiding Judge: Richard Seeborg
Nature of Suit: Patent
Cause of Action: 35 U.S.C. ยง 271
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ff
